get the intake if you can find one cheap enough. the k&n isn't that great, they flow better because they let more crap through, so they are oiled tp help catch more dirt. a foam filter is the best though, they don't flow as good as a k&n, but filter out dirt a lot better, hence most offroad vehicles use them, and companies like greddy and hks use them for their turbo kits
